Alonso ahead of Schumacher in French practice

Magny-Cours, France - World championship leader Fernando Alonso beat Michael Schumacher by almost half a second in Friday practice for the French Formula One Grand Prix.

In what is the home Grand Prix for his Renault team and tyre makers Michelin, Alonso clocked 1 minute 17.498 minutes for the 4.411-kilometres lap.

Team-mate Giancarlo Fisichella posted a time of 1:17.916 while Ferrari star Schumacher followed with 1:17.938 in a session led by BMW test driver Robert Kubica (1:16.902) who is only eligible for Friday practice.

Renault's strength is a first indication that they are ready to rebound from the poor showing at the last race in Indianapolis, where Schumacher and Felipe Massa scored a Ferrari one-two ahead of Fisichella while Alonso finished a season-worst fifth.

Alonso leads the title race with 88 points to Schumacher's 69 after 10 of 18 races.

Both, Alonso and Schumacher, were happy with their performance with modified cars compared to the Indianapolis race two weeks ago.

'I think we now have a clear picture,' said Alonso. 'The modified engine is a good step forward and it ran without any problems. That is very encouraging. Things are looking good.'

Schumacher did not want to comment on the Renault but also said that 'things are going quite well. It is a step forward.'

Pedro de la Rosa, meanwhile, clocked 1 minute 19.809 seconds as the new McLaren team-mate of Kimi Raikkonen.

De la Rosa was promoted from test driver after Mclaren ended the contract of Juan Pablo Montoya after the Colombian announced a 2007 move to NASCAR racing in the US.

The qualifying session is set for Saturday and the 70-lap race is on Sunday.
